Types of At-Home Teeth Whitening Kits
There are several types of at-home teeth whitening kits available on the market today. Each has its unique approach to delivering a brighter smile. Here is a breakdown of the most common types:
- Whitening Strips: Thin, flexible plastic strips coated with a whitening gel are applied directly to the teeth. They’re easy to use and typically require daily application for two weeks.
- Whitening Gels and Trays: This method involves using a tray filled with a peroxide-based gel that you wear over your teeth. The trays can be custom-fitted or one-size-fits-all.
- Whitening Pens: Designed for convenience, these pens allow you to apply the whitening gel directly to your teeth. They’re popular for touch-ups.
- LED Light Kits: These kits combine a whitening gel with a light source to enhance the whitening effect. The LED light is believed to accelerate the whitening process.
The Science Behind At-Home Whitening
The products within these kits generally use peroxide-based compounds to break down stains on the teeth. The peroxide penetrates the tooth enamel, leading to a lighter shade. It’s essential to note that results can vary based on the original tooth color, the type of stains, and adherence to the product instructions.

Natural Teeth Whitening Alternatives Gaining Popularity
In recent years, the demand for natural teeth whitening alternatives has significantly increased. Many people are now looking for safer and more eco-friendly options to enhance their smiles. If you’re curious about natural methods to achieve whiter teeth, you’ll find several exciting trends and products gaining steam, and they make great alternatives to chemical treatments.
Whitening strips and gels that often contain harsh chemicals like hydrogen peroxide can lead to sensitivity and enamel erosion. As a result, consumers are turning toward natural teeth whitening solutions that are not only effective but also promote overall oral health. Here are some of the popular natural methods currently trending:
1. Activated Charcoal
Activated charcoal is a buzzword in the beauty and wellness industry, and its whitening capabilities have led to its rise in oral care products. When used properly, activated charcoal can absorb stains and toxins from the teeth, resulting in a brighter smile. Many brands have begun incorporating this ingredient into toothpaste and powder form for easy use.
2. Coconut Oil Pulling
Coconut oil pulling involves swishing virgin coconut oil in your mouth for about 10-20 minutes. This ancient Ayurvedic practice is believed to reduce plaque, freshen breath, and contribute to teeth whitening. While research is still limited, many individuals swear by its effectiveness and prefer it as an all-natural approach.
3. Baking Soda and Lemon Juice
The combination of baking soda and lemon juice has been popularized as a DIY whitening solution. Baking soda is mildly abrasive, helping to scrub away surface stains, while lemon juice contains citric acid known for its bleaching effects. However, this method should be used cautiously; excessive lemon juice can erode enamel if overused. Aim for moderation with this home remedy to protect your teeth.
4. Fruits and Vegetables
Some fruits and vegetables can help in naturally whitening your teeth. Strawberries contain malic acid, which can help remove surface stains. Additionally, crunchy vegetables like carrots and celery can help scrub your teeth while eating and promote saliva production, which is essential for oral health.
5. Herbal Rinses
Many are exploring herbal rinses using natural ingredients like sage, mint, and green tea. These rinses can assist in maintaining a healthy mouth while potentially lightening tooth color. Green tea, besides being rich in antioxidants, also helps combat bacteria in the mouth.

Safety and Efficacy of Modern Teeth Whitening Products
In the world of cosmetic dentistry, the rise of modern teeth whitening products has created immense interest, particularly in regards to their safety and efficacy. With an ever-growing market and ever-evolving products, understanding how safe these items are and how effectively they work is crucial. Here, we dive deep into the safety and effectiveness of contemporary teeth whitening solutions, helping you make informed choices.
Types of Modern Teeth Whitening Products
When it comes to teeth whitening, several products have gained popularity over the years. These can be broadly classified as follows:
- Whitening Toothpastes: These contain mild abrasives and special detergents to help remove surface stains.
- Whitening Strips: Flexible plastic strips coated with a hydrogen peroxide gel, these are incredibly popular due to their ease of use.
- Whitening Gels and Pens: These products often come with a brush applicator and can be applied directly to the teeth.
- In-Office Treatments: Performed by dental professionals, these treatments typically use stronger bleaching agents for quicker results.
- At-Home Whitening Kits: These kits usually include custom trays and a bleaching solution that you can use at your convenience.
Analyzing Safety
Safety is a significant consideration when adopting any whitening treatment. Here are essential points to consider:
- Ingredient Composition: Most modern teeth whitening products contain either hydrogen peroxide or carbamide peroxide as their active ingredients. Research has shown that these compounds are generally safe when used according to guidelines.
- Concentration Levels: Higher concentrations can lead to increased sensitivity. Products with lower concentrations (less than 10% hydrogen peroxide) may be gentler but take longer to show results.
- ADA Seal of Acceptance: Choosing products that bear this seal can enhance safety as they have passed rigorous testing.
Efficacy and Results
Efficacy refers to how well the products perform in whitening teeth. Here are the crucial aspects:
- Treatment Duration: In-office treatments can lead to significant whitening in just one session, whereas at-home options may take a few weeks to achieve desired results.
- Whitening Degrees: Many products promise several shades whiter teeth; studies indicate whitening can range between 1-3 shades for at-home products and 4-6 shades for in-office treatments.
- Resistance to Stains: A major benefit of effective teeth whitening is its ability to resist new stains. Patients often enjoy maintaining a brighter smile with proper care post-treatment.
Risks and Side Effects
Though modern teeth whitening products are generally safe, some users may experience side effects. Awareness of these can help you prepare:
- Zinger Sensitivity: Temporary sensitivity in teeth after treatment is common, typically resolving within a few days.
- Irritated Gums: Contact with whitening agents can occasionally irritate gum tissue, leading to mild discomfort.
- Overuse Effects: Extensively using whitening products can lead to enamel erosion. Therefore, following the instructions is essential.
